Term Mining in Biomedicine
2007-05-03
Dr Ananiadou will give a talk about Term Mining in Biomedicine as part of the NLIP Seminar Series at the University of Cambridge. The talk will focus on techniques for automatically recognising and structuring terminology from literature based on the work done at the National Centre for Text Mining and the EU BOOTSTrep project.
